CS460/660 - Machine Learning
Syllabus
- Learning, Inductive Bias, Features, Labels, Basics of Statistics and Probability
- Supervised Learning - Some models
- Ensemble Methods: Bagging, Boosting. Learning Theory
- Unsupervised Learning - Some models
- Reinforcement Learning (if time permits)
Prerequisite
- Algorithms (CS301 or equivalent)
- Basic Programming Skills
Grading Scheme
- Assignments - 60 marks
- Mid-Term - No midterm
- End-Term - 40 marks
- *In case, there is no endterm, total marks will be based on Assignments

Books
Some recommended books on Machine learning.
- The Elements of Statistical Learning Link
- Mathematics for Machine Learning Link
- Introduction to Machine Learning with Python Link
- A course in Machine Learning Link
